Abstract

There are many errors on Job Application Letter (JAL) as task of lecture. The errors can be analizyzed based on EYD which consist of letters, words, and punctuations. Specifically, this research aims at explaining the errors of using letters, words, and punctuationson JAL for the students of IKIP PGRI Madiun. This research is descriptive qualitative explaining the phenomena occurred on JAL of IKIP PGRI Madiun students. The qualitative data research and primary data source research are gained using writing document technique of students JAL. The validation data technique used are method and experts triangulations. The technique of data analysis is using interactive model analysis. The result of this research shows that there are 25 similar errors of students JAL. The errors appeared at the 6 errors of using letters, 15 errors of using word, and 4 errors of using punctuations.Keywords : EYD, the study of error analysis, Job Application Letter (JAL)

Abstract

This study aims to understand the publication trend and research contribution related to character education in Indonesian high school textbooks based on the Merdeka Curriculum from 2015 to 2024. Character education is crucial for student development, and textbooks play a central role. Using bibliometric analysis, the study identified 428 publications from Google Scholar and Scopus, including journal articles, proceedings, reviews, and books. Journal articles dominated with 363 publications, followed by 30 proceedings, 32 books, and three reviews. The study focused on the number of publications and the issues underlying the keyword emergence. While 2023 had the highest number of publications (75), 2018 saw the highest citations (890) and h-index (14), indicating significant influence. The highly cited study "Strategy and Implementation of Character Education in Senior High Schools and Vocational High Schools" had 135 citations. Keyword analysis using VOSviewer revealed that "Indonesian textbook" was the most popular topic, particularly concerning gender representation and basic education. Despite increased productivity, recent publications need higher impact, achievable through improved research quality, appropriate journal selection, online dissemination, collaboration, and scientific community engagement. The focus on gender representation and basic education should be sharpened for inclusive teaching materials and to instill positive values early in Indonesian education. This study provides valuable insights and direction for future research and practice in character education within the Independent Curriculum framework.

Abstract

Writing official letters should use good and correct language. This is to make it easier for readers to understand the writing that will be written. The data obtained came from official letters at the Maospati District Office. After the data was analyzed, many errors were found, including the use of spelling, word choice and effective sentences. Errors in the use of spelling contained in official letters at the Maospati District Office, namely errors in writing capital letters, italics, bold letters, prepositions, abbreviations and acronyms, numbers and numbers, periods, commas, colons, hyphens, and a slash. The most errors lie in writing capital letters, while the fewest errors lie in writing numbers and numbers. Errors in the use of word choices contained in official letters at the Maospati District Office, namely errors in the use of words that are non-standard, unfamiliar, impolite and inaccurate. The most errors lie in writing inaccurate words, while the fewest errors lie in writing impolite words. Errors in the use of effective sentences contained in official letters at the Maospati District Office, namely errors in the use of sentences that are not commensurate, not parallel, not economical, not accurate and illogical.

Abstract

This study aims to describe and explain the form of adherence to the principles of language politeness found in the comments column of the 2024 presidential candidate debate event on youtube kompastv. This research uses descriptive qualitative research method. The data in this study were obtained from the comments of netizens taken randomly at the first and fifth debates of the 2024 presidential candidates on youtube kompastv. This research uses working tools in the form of data cards and indicators of language politeness principles. The data collection techniques used are listening and note-taking techniques. The data analysis technique used an interactive analysis model. The results of this study found 21 data that included the depth of violation of the principles of language politeness. The amount of data found on the maxim of wisdom amounted to 4 data; the maxim of generosity amounted to 3 data; the maxim of praise amounted to 5 data; the maxim of humility amounted to 2 data; the maxim of sympathy amounted to 4 data; and the maxim of agreement amounted to 3 data. Violation of the principle of language politeness in this study is mostly found in the maxim of praise.
